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,524,171
Lastest Block:
1,963,500
Utxos:
1,983,814
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
08/09/2022 17:08:00 UTC
Txid
55b6ed0e0024b9d80e94f3fd715d976561c7325c9cb13b9e9009f8604e9fd661
Block
670,726
Block hash
6c3a2872b6a3ecbda8af8a29b48fdb72dbf78ccd9251b6ee4b3e59b81f902e07
Stake amount
684.51432091 XEP
Sender
ep1qzs362jejse0fhvjdqk57m0tz50zjwrrgyz300x
Recipient
ep1q3x24v4u7w5wcg5fq5s2vtun3hl7ahu89rm8j9p
(1,107,021.40245334 XEP)